How much do fulltime event planner j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 20, 2026, the average hourly pay for fulltime event planner in Decatur, GA is $29.73,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$23.46 and $34.52 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Fulltime Event Planner vs Part-time Event Planner?

AspectFulltime Event PlannerPart-time Event Planner
Work HoursTypically 35-40 hours per weekFewer hours, often less than 20 hours per week
Job StabilityMore stable, with consistent employmentLess stable, often project-based or seasonal
CertificationsOften required or preferred (e.g., CMP, CSEP)May not require certifications, but beneficial
Work EnvironmentOffice, event venues, client sitesSimilar, but with more flexibility

Fulltime Event Planners work regular hours with stable employment, often holding certifications, and are employed by organizations or agencies. Part-time Event Planners have flexible schedules, may not hold certifications, and typically work on specific events or projects. Both roles require strong organizational skills and industry knowledge, but differ mainly in hours, stability, and certification requirements.

Role description:

Arcadis seeks a full-time Transportation Planner/Engineer to join an innovative and collaborative group of skilled planners, engineers, data analysts, and modelers in the Atlanta office. The interdisciplinary team is actively engaged with state, regional, and local partners to support a variety of transportation projects across the nation and globally.

In this position, you will assist our growing Mobility Advisory Team utilizing our expertise to address transportation challenges. We focus on developing sustainable transportation solutions that enhance mobility and improve quality of life for communities. Our work encompasses various aspects such as transportation planning, public transportation, active transportation, and multimodal integration. We strive to create seamless and interconnected transportation networks that cater to the diverse needs of the communities we serve. We collaborate with clients and stakeholders to design and implement projects that prioritize safety, accessibility, and environmental sustainability. With our expertise in data analysis and transportation modeling we optimize the flow of people and goods, reduce congestion, and enhance overall mobility. 

Role accountabilities:

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Act as a project resource through leading data collection and analysis efforts, providing technical transportation planning guidance, and assisting in review of design solutions.
  • Contribute to the development of planning reports, deliverables, and other project-related documents that meet both Arcadis standards and client requirements.
  • Regularly liaise with Project Managers and staff from other design disciplines within Arcadis and from partner firms to support successful project delivery.
  • Work with Project Managers on management tasks, including coordinating internal and external meetings, organizing document repositories, and ensuring timely delivery of project deliverables.
  • Attend and contribute to client, stakeholder, and public engagement meetings and events as needed.

Qualifications & Experience:

Required Qualifications

  • Demonstrated experience with transportation and/or urban planning for multi-disciplinary projects.
  • 2-3 years of related transportation planning experience.
  • Bachelor's degree in civil or transportation engineering, planning or related field.
  • Ability to work in a high-pace environment with the flexibility to work on multiple projects.
  • Excellent communication skills with clear, grammatically correct technical/business writing.
  • Fluency in the MS Office software suite, with strong abilities in Excel, Word, and PowerPoint are required.
